SQLite Migration + Prefill Plan

Date: 2026-02-08

Goals

  • Remove Redux entirely and move all state into SQLite for performance and simplicity.
  • Support multiple sources (Jellyfin/Emby) with a unified driver interface.
  • Make SQLite the primary, offline-first source of truth.
  • Prefill the database by crawling all sources with paging, bounded concurrency, and resume support.

Current State Summary

  • Redux slices: settings, music (albums, tracks, playlists, artists), downloads, search, sleep timer.
  • Jellyfin API utilities fetch full lists without paging (except small limits on search, recent, instant mix).
  • No existing prefill framework or cursor state.

Data Model (Filter-Only + metadata_json)

  • Promote only fields used for filtering/sorting.
  • Store all remaining entity fields in metadata_json (TEXT, JSON-encoded).
  • No metadata_json table. No metadata_json on settings.
  • Add created_at and updated_at (epoch ms) on updateable tables.
  • Rename server to source throughout schema.
  • Add explicit lyrics column on tracks and album_similar relation table.
  • Downloads include hash, filename, mimetype.
  • No sort_name columns anywhere.
  • app_settings and sleep_timer are global, no source_id.

API Paging Updates

  • Rewrite all Jellyfin/Emby API wrappers into their respective drivers.
  • Add paging support to driver methods for list endpoints:
    • getAlbums, getArtists, getTracks, getPlaylists, getTracksByAlbum, getTracksByPlaylist
  • Parameters: startIndex, limit
  • Default limit = 500

Prefill Framework

  • Orchestrator runs for each source and writes pages directly to SQLite.
  • Concurrency: max 5 requests.
  • Page size: 500.
  • Resume: sync_cursors per source + entity type.

Prefill Order

  1. Artists
  2. Albums
  3. Tracks
  4. Playlists
  5. Album tracks
  6. Playlist tracks
  7. Similar albums
  8. Lyrics

Behavior

  • Fetch a page, upsert into SQLite, discard page data to keep memory flat.
  • Enqueue dependent tasks only after parent entities exist.
  • Update sync_cursors after each page.
  • Continue until no items returned; mark completed.

Testing and Validation

  • Smoke test: single source, verify counts and basic queries.
  • Resume test: interrupt prefill, restart, confirm cursor resume.
  • Paging test: compare page 1 and page 2 IDs for non-overlap.
  • Query performance: verify common sorts and filters are indexed.
